Job Title: Business Systems Analyst II, ERP Salary Range: $65,000 - $75,000
Department: Business Technology
Classification: Exempt / Salary
Reports to: Director of Enterprise Services
Job Qualifications:
Bachelor’s Degree in IT or equivalent professional experience, and at least two additional years of related professional ERP experience.
Professional certifications related to application/software development strongly desired.
Working knowledge and 2 years of experience with various report-writing mediums (Crystal Reports, Power BI, SSRS, web pages, etc.).
Intermediate to advanced experience with coding in various languages, including SQL, C#, Visual Basic, HTML, XML and Java or TypeScript.
Considerable Enterprise Resource Planning database familiarity with emphasis on operating within a Microsoft environment.
Basic understanding of Web services.
Demonstrated breadth and depth of experience regarding data collection, analysis, reconciliation and a proven ability to document and report findings.
Warehouse Management System and inventory control experience preferred.
A true team player who enjoys collaborating, learning from or teaching others in order to work towards personal goals while achieving company goals.
Driven self-starter who can collect user requirements, define scope objectives, and create system specifications that drive implementations and modifications.
Basic understanding of network and database administration preferred.
Requires sound written and verbal communication skills; must be able to communicate effectively to a technical audience, non-technical audience and C-level executives where interpreting and forecasting data might drive successful business ventures.
Ability to act as liaison between the user community, internal IT resources and external IT consultants effectively and in a timely manner.
Dynamically research, create and document ERP standard operating procedures.
Ability to create, maintain and troubleshoot security profiles and access issues within the ERP.
Strong problem-solving skills and creative thinking needed for timely resolution of IS issues.
Demonstrate a powerful sense of internal customer service and strong work ethic to positively contribute to the company’s mission and vision.
Job Summary:
The Business Systems Analyst II - ERP is responsible for leveraging the company’s information technology resources in the most efficient manner possible, thereby optimizing the productivity of all users and enabling management to make timely, accurate and informed decisions in all things related to the enterprise resource planning software.
Assist VP of Information Technology and Director of Enterprise Systems with scoping of projects aimed at achieving corporate objectives. Oversee design and administration of such projects, and coordinate with IT team to deploy them. Maintain and troubleshoot an array of software platforms including, but not limited to, WMS, ERP, CRM, ECOM and Power BI. Support fellow IT department personnel’s endeavors to facilitate resolutions to internal and external customer needs and converting data into information. Supervise activities, help test and properly implement any vendors engaged in ERP-related projects. Help coordinate activities with others in the department when further direction is necessary to ensure forward progress and a comprehensive, consistent approach.
